What should I do if I smell gas near my water heater?

Leave the house immediately, avoid operating any switches or appliances, and call your gas utility's emergency line from a safe location. This takes priority over calling for a repair.

My water heater is making noise but still works — is that a problem?

Popping or rumbling sounds usually indicate sediment buildup at the bottom of the tank. It's not always urgent, but it's worth having flushed or inspected before it affects the unit's lifespan.

Should I repair or replace my gas water heater?

It generally depends on the unit's age and what's failed. A control valve or thermocouple issue on a newer tank is usually worth repairing; a rusting tank near the end of its typical service life is often better replaced. A technician can advise after inspecting it.
